My current not very experienced medication provider told me that I should feel mood improvement and more stable after seven pills of lithium, each one 300mg. So, about 4 days.

I need to know if his assertion is realistic? I need the experiences of others who have been on lithium. How soon did you feel the effects (good or bad)? What dose did you start at, and how far up did you go (if lithium worked for you)?

I kinda already said this in the bipolar check in but I'll post some more info here too. I don't think it's realistic. I started at 600mg/day split up 300am and 300pm and that did nothing so after a week they added another 300mg and then after a week my mania was brought down to a hypomania. After another week they raised it to 1200mg and then that's when I was finally stable.

I do wish that they had lowered the dose after I was stable awhile to 900mg though because 1200mg had some GI upsets after about a month of being on that dose.
